Proven Strategies to Effectively Promote Your Club Membership to Law Enforcement Personnel
1. Craft Targeted Messaging That Resonates with Law Enforcement Needs
Develop messaging that highlights durability, ergonomic design, and professional aesthetics—key factors officers prioritize. Use authentic language reflecting their lifestyle and work priorities to build trust and relevance.
2. Offer Exclusive Product Lines and Priority Access for Members
Design limited-edition furniture collections with reinforced materials suited to policing environments. Grant members early access to new products, creating a sense of exclusivity and urgency.
3. Develop a Loyalty Rewards Program That Drives Engagement
Reward repeat purchases, referrals, and product reviews with points redeemable for discounts, upgrades, or accessories. This incentivizes ongoing interaction and strengthens customer loyalty.
4. Partner with Police Associations and Unions to Boost Credibility
Collaborate with trusted organizations to co-promote your membership program. Leveraging their networks enhances credibility and expands your reach within the law enforcement community.
5. Utilize Real-Time Feedback Tools Like Zigpoll to Capture Customer Insights
Deploy brief, targeted surveys immediately after purchases or service interactions using tools like Zigpoll, Typeform, or SurveyMonkey to gather officers’ preferences and pain points. Use these insights to continuously refine products and messaging.
6. Create Practical Content Marketing Focused on Officer Challenges
Produce blogs, videos, and guides demonstrating how your furniture addresses specific law enforcement needs—such as ergonomic support during long shifts or durable materials that resist wear.
7. Personalize Onboarding with Tailored Communications and Welcome Kits
Welcome new members with role-specific product recommendations, branded accessories, and exclusive webinars on furniture care and ergonomics to make them feel valued and engaged.
8. Implement a Referral Incentives Program to Encourage Organic Growth
Motivate current members to refer peers by offering tiered rewards and easy-to-share referral links, leveraging the power of trusted networks.
9. Ensure a Mobile-Friendly, Streamlined Sign-Up Experience
Optimize your website and membership portal for mobile devices by simplifying form fields and enabling social sign-ins, reducing friction and increasing conversions.
10. Maintain Regular, Segmented Communication to Keep Members Engaged
Send newsletters featuring product tips, industry news, and exclusive offers tailored to different officer roles, ensuring ongoing relevance and engagement.
